This is what I think you people need to do. STOP using Redhat. As of April 30th, 2004 Redhat 9 Shrike will no longer be suppoted through the errata. As everyone knows it is Redhats policy to support and fix errors for 1 year after a realase then to stop supporting it. Redhat has gone totally commercial and is no longer interested in the whole theory behind GPL. To be free forever. I would personally suggest using Gentoo or Debian. Although it is not for the unexperienced it is a damn good linux distro. If you want to use linux use LINUX not a distro of linux that reminds you of windows. I still must make a suggestion for those of us that are new to this whole linux thing. Get yourself a copy of mandrake 9.1. Its a great OS and is easy to use. :twisted:
